In this episode of Dear 21-Year-Old Me, with guest Russell Dixon.

  • We go back in time to 1996, when our guest, Russell Dixon, turned 21, and look at what was happening in the world, and closer to home back then.

  • Russell reflects on his experiences growing up in Dunedin, New Zealand, and then he eventually got involved in the world of entertainment.
     
  • We talk about how Russell's leadership style on and off stage has evolved, and Russell and Jeremy share reflections on some of the lessons from a show they were in together. 

  • Russell looks back on his career, including having worked overseas, and his leadership lessons from his time during a two-year show run.

  • Russell talks about his sense of optimism, what he teaches about leadership, and what he's learned along the way.

  • We ask Russell what he'd say to his 21-year-old self, and what Russell at 21 would say to Russell now.
